Godrej Consumer Products‘ share price declined by 5 percent in the morning session on January 8, 2024. The company announced expectations of low-single-digit sales for the quarter ended December 31. The company stated that the domestic operating environment for FMCG companies mirrored the previous quarter, marked by low rural offtake. Nevertheless, Godrej anticipates maintaining steady underlying volume growth in the mid-single digits.

GCPL reported broad-based growth across Home Care and Personal Care segments, highlighting strong performance from the Park Avenue and KamaSutra brands, which are on track to meet the full-year targets.

Despite this growth, the company foresees flat sales growth in rupee terms, attributing it to year-on-year expansion in EBITDA (including Forex) margin despite increased category development investments.

However, the LATAM business faced significant challenges due to the sharp devaluation of the Argentinian Peso from 361 to 808. It resulted in severe impacts on revenue for nine months due to hyperinflation. This situation is expected to negatively impact consolidated sales by a mid-single-digit percentage.

The company stated that despite the challenging environment, the LATAM business continued to achieve positive volume growth, with minimal effects on profit.
